After purchasing and downloading Lori's file, I used my Silhouette to enlarge the two box pieces so that the square in the center of the lid was 4"x4". I cut out both pieces and used a strong liquid glue to adhere them.
Next, I cut a small slit in the top of my box lid, and put one end of a 30" ribbon through the top of the lid. I adhered the end to the top of the lid and covered it with several layers of card stock, cherry petite prints, and Lots of Luck pattern paper.
To add the enamel heart sprinkles to the white box base, I used a craft knife to position each heart through the cut outs in the lid. I will definitely be getting more of these! Love them!
For the photos, I adhered six 3.5"x3.5" white card stock squares along the ribbon and added 3.25"x3.25" pattern paper to the front and back of each square. Each of my 12 photos were cropped to 3"x3" and adhered over the pattern paper mats.
Finally, I adhered 6 Doodle-Pop hearts (3 back to back) to finish off the end of the ribbon. It was a fun way to showcase a few pictures of "the bug", aka my granddaughter :).
